随着互联网的迅速发展,获取和观看电影的方式也在不断变化。很多人希望能够免费观看电影,然而,很多视频网站都采用了付费订阅模式。这使得一些技术爱好者开始寻找利用编程手段获取影片资源的方法。在这里,我们将探讨如何使用Python进行爬虫编程,帮助你获取免费观看电影的源码解析与应用方法。

首先,了解爬虫的基本概念是至关重要的。网络爬虫是一种自动访问互联网并提取信息的技术,通常用于获取网页内容。在开始使用Python进行爬虫之前,需要安装一些必要的库,如requests和BeautifulSoup。requests库用于发送网络请求,而BeautifulSoup则用于解析返回的HTML文档。安装这些库的方法很简单,可以通过Python的包管理工具pip完成:在命令行中输入“pip install requests beautifulsoup4”即可。

接下来,选择一个合适的目标网站是爬虫的关键步骤。在大多数情况下,免费影视资源网站会受到严格的版权保护,因此在爬取内容之前,一定要了解相关法律法规,确保自己的行为不会侵犯他人的权益。选好目标网站后,可以用requests库发送GET请求,获取网页内容。使用BeautifulSoup解析网页后,你就能提取出电影的标题、链接、剧照等信息。以下是一个简单的示例代码:

如何利用Python获取免费观看电影的源码解析与应用方法

```python
import requests
from bs4 import BeautifulSoup

url = '目标网站URL'
response = requests.get(url)
soup = BeautifulSoup(response.content, 'html.parser')
movies = soup.find_all('div', class_='movie-item')
for movie in movies:
title = movie.find('h2').text
link = movie.find('a')['href']
print(f'电影标题: {title}, 链接: {link}')
```

运行上述代码后,就能在控制台中看到提取出来的电影标题和链接。为了提升爬虫的效率,可以考虑添加一些浏览器伪装头部信息,以避免被网站识别。此外,合理控制请求频率,避免对目标网站造成过大的压力,这样能够增加爬取成功的概率。

当然,获取到电影链接后,你还需要一个合适的播放器来观看影片。现在很多开源的媒体播放器,如VLC、MPV等,都支持通过URL播放视频。只需将获取到的影片链接导入播放器,就能享受到在线电影的乐趣。当然,不同国家和地区对内容的访问规定不同,务必要遵守相关法律法规。

总的来说,通过Python爬虫技术获取免费观看电影是一项充满挑战与乐趣的任务。在实践过程中,不仅能够提升编程能力,还能够培养逻辑思维和数据分析能力。但是,个人用户在利用这些技术时,务必要遵循法律法规,以合法合规为前提,确保自己的学习与探索不越过法律的界限。